The sticky keys feature lets you use modifier keys like Ctrl, Alt, Shift, and the Windows key without pressing the modifier key simultaneously with another key. All you have to do to turn it on is press Shift five times in a row. Therefore, Sticky Keys allows a user to press a key-like Shift or Ctrl-to use it without needing to hold it to use it as part of a key combination.
